Gentle Movements: A Holistic Approach to Healing
The exercises demonstrated in the video are a simple yet effective way to relax tight pelvic floor muscles, which can often lead to discomfort during activities ranging from exercise to intimate moments. Many might not realize that tightness in the pelvic floor can cause back pain, hip pain, and even discomfort during penetration or tampon insertion. This flow incorporates hip mobility and focuses on releasing tension, creating a pathway for healing and relaxation.
Dr. Enis emphasizes the importance of breathing throughout the exercises. Breathing deeply into the belly, allowing a gentle exhale, can create an additional layer of relaxation, guiding the muscles to unwind. This mindful approach transforms the practice from mere physical movements into a gentle meditation for the body and mind.

Potential Barriers and Overcoming Misconceptions
Some may hold misconceptions about pelvic floor exercises, viewing them as exclusively beneficial for pregnant or postpartum women. However, pelvic floor health is important for everyone, regardless of gender or life stage. Men can experience pelvic floor dysfunction as well, often resulting in similar discomforts.
Engaging in these gentle movements can break down barriers of discomfort and stigma, promoting healthier conversations about pelvic health. Acknowledging and addressing pelvic tension can significantly enhance quality of life.
